PSYC 0523 - Counseling Basics


Credits: 3

Designed to help counselors to develop an understanding of the issues involved in helping relationships dealing with persons having educational, vocational, interpersonal and intrapersonal problems. Techniques and abilities to apply basic counseling skills will be stressed. Pre-practicum hours for Licensure are included in the course requirements..

Prerequisites: PSYC 0101 Introduction to Psychology, PSYC 0201 Theories of Personality, PSYC 0522 - Theories of Counseling . EXCEPT WITH PERMISSION OF THE PROGRAM DIRECTOR, THIS COURSE IS LIMITED TOSTUDENTS WHO ARE MATRICULATED IN THE M.A. PSYCHOLOGY PROGRAM AT WSU.
